Why is 811,360 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 811,360 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 5 8 10 11 16 20 22 32 40 44 55 80 88 110 160 176 220 352 440 461 880 922 1,760 1,844 2,305 3,688 4,610 5,071 7,376 9,220 10,142 14,752 18,440 20,284 25,355 36,880 40,568 50,710 73,760 81,136 101,420 162,272 202,840 405,680 and 811,360, with no remainder.

Since 811,360 cannot be divided by just 1 and 811,360, it is a composite number.
